Any modification that involves removing part of the roof will make the body twist more. I had a Supra Turbo targa top and when the top was removed, you could feel the body twisting because the roof was not there to help prevent the twisting. It is awesome to have a targa and I think an MX-3 targa would be a sight to see (and fun to drive). Perhaps if anyone did decide to make this mod, they should probably have some subframe connectors created to help reduce body twisting. Just a suggestion.
